    Nothing Phone 3 Appears on GeekBench with Snapdragon 7s Gen 3

    Nothing has not missed the chance to unveil its top-tier smartphones this year, with the latest premium model, Phone (2), introduced in 2023. Now, details about its successor have emerged on a benchmarking platform, revealing the chipset that will power the forthcoming Nothing Phone (3). Let’s dive into the specifics.

    Nothing Phone (3): A Shift to Mid-Range?

    Recent leaks show the new device on the GeekBench platform (Via 91Mobiles), with the model number A059, which is believed to be the Nothing Phone (3). This model boasts the Qualcomm Snapdragon 7s Gen 3 SoC and comes with 8GB of RAM. The performance benchmarks indicate that it achieved 1,149 points in the single-core test and 2,813 points in the multi-core test. The listing also indicates it will come with Android 15 OS right out of the box, likely based on the NothingOS 3.0 custom interface.

    A Surprising Direction?

    It might seem peculiar, given that the Nothing Phone (2) was a high-end device featuring Qualcomm’s flagship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 SoC. Therefore, the transition back to a mid-range option with the Phone (3) might remind some of the Phone (1). However, this could just represent the entry-level model of the Phone (3) lineup. A few months ago, two unidentified Nothing Phones appeared in the IMEI database, labeled A059 and A059P, with the latter likely representing a more powerful Pro version.

    Launch Timeline and Features

    As per the current information, the launch of the Nothing Phone (3) could be postponed until 2025. There are also hints that it might come with an Action Button. The standard Nothing Phone (3) is expected to have a 6.5-inch display, while the Nothing Phone (3) Pro could feature a larger 6.7-inch screen. Initially, there were rumors of the third iteration being equipped with the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3, but it seems to be shifting towards a mid-range status again. Meanwhile, the Pro variant could be named the Nothing Phone (3)+ and may utilize the Dimensity 9400 SoC.

    First Look: Nothing Phone (3) with Action Button Revealed

    Nothing’s flagship phones traditionally launch in July, with the Phone (1) and Phone (2) unveiled in the same month in 2022 and 2023. The London-based company is likely to continue this pattern with the Phone (3), marking its next significant product reveal. While details about the Nothing Phone (3) remain scarce, Carl Pei has shared an image on X hinting at a crucial feature.

    Possible New Action Button on Nothing Phone (3)

    Pei posted an image showcasing the redesigned quick settings and notification panel of the Nothing OS, anticipated to be part of Nothing OS 3 later this year. The redesign appears on a mockup of the device, which at first glance resembles the Phone (2) and Phone (1).

    However, keen observers will notice a new button on the right frame, just beneath the power key. This small button suggests it could be an action button, an alert slider, or a dedicated camera shutter button. The action button feature is present on the iPhone 15 Pro models, while the alert slider is common on OnePlus phones. Additionally, the power and volume rocker keys are positioned higher on the device.

    Speculations and Features

    The speculation surrounding this new physical button indicates it might be included in the upcoming Nothing Phone (3). The mockup shows the device with a metal frame, a centrally placed punch-hole cutout, and minimal screen bezels. Rumors suggest the Phone (3) will be powered by a Snapdragon 8s Gen 3 processor.     Nothing Phone 3 to Showcase Latest Snapdragon 8-Series Chip

    Brand Nothing recently unveiled a sneak peek of the upcoming Nothing Ear (3) TWS earbuds. In addition to this reveal, reports from 91mobiles Hindi suggest that the company is also developing the Nothing Phone 3, which will come equipped with a fresh Snapdragon 8-series chipset. Let’s delve into the initial insights about the Phone 3.

    Unveiling the Nothing Phone 3 Chipset (rumored)

    Insiders have shared that the Nothing Phone 3 is poised to feature the Snapdragon 8s Gen 3 chipset. This particular chip made its debut in the Xiaomi Civi 4 Pro recently in China.

    The Snapdragon 8s Gen 3 is anticipated to power several other smartphones within the Chinese market, including the Redmi Turbo 3, the Realme GT Neo 6, and the iQOO Z9 Turbo. While the global release of the iQOO and Realme phones remains uncertain, the Redmi Turbo 3 will be rebranded as the Poco F6 outside of China.

    Market Competition and Pricing

    It appears that the Nothing Phone 3 might encounter competition from the Poco F6 in international markets. However, the initial leak exclusively discloses the chipset details, leaving other specifications undisclosed.

    As per the report, the anticipated price range for the Nothing Phone 3 in India falls between Rs 40,000 ($480) and Rs 45,000 ($540). Alongside this information, a recent teaser from the brand showcases an intriguing frog. Previous teasers for Phone 1 and Phone 2 featured a pear and an octopus, respectively, hinting that the Phone 3’s teasers might involve a frog. The Phone 3 is expected to be unveiled in July.

    Specifications of the Phone 2a

    Recent rumors surrounding the Phone 2a suggest that the device will feature a tall 6.7-inch A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ate and FHD+ resolution. On the rear, it is expected to house a 50-megapixel Samsung S5KGN9 shooter with a 1/1.5 inch sensor size and 1.0 micron pixel size. Alongside this, a 50-megapixel Samsung S5KJN1 ultra-wide-angle lens with a 1/2.76 inch sensor size and 0.64-micron pixel size is also anticipated. For selfies and video calls, the front of the device is rumored to sport a 32-megapixel Sony IMX615 camera.
